Action Steps
- Split your dataset into training, validation, and testing sets using tools like Scikit-learn or Pandas
- Use the training set to train your machine learning model
- Evaluate your model's performance on the validation set to tune hyperparameters
- Test your model's performance on the testing set to ensure reliability
- Compare the performance of different models using metrics like accuracy and F1 score
